Maddux was not your "luckiest" pitcher last year when it comes to run support..... pitcher RS/G Mitre 5.43 Zambrano 4.79 Wood 4.70 Prior 4.56 Maddux 4.54 Rusch 4.07 Williams 3.76 Koronka 3.67 Hill 3.00 Dempster 3.00 Overall 4.34 In 2/3 of Maddux's starts last year the CUBS scored 5 runs or less. This does not lend itself to winning games 8-6 and 7-5.
